Craisin Salad


Here is a salad I tasted for the first time around 8 or 9 years ago at a family gathering. When I realized I was still thinking about this salad weeks or maybe even months after eating it, I made my husband call his aunt and get the recipe! You will not be disappointed with this salad. It is really easy to make and tastes great with a variety of main dishes. Give it a try!

Salad:
1 head of Romaine
1 C. sliced almonds
2 to 3 TBS. sugar
1 C. craisins
1/3 C. purple onion, sliced in paper thin quarters

Dressing:
1/2 C. apple cider vinegar
1/4 C. brown sugar
1/2 tsp. onion salt
1 tsp. vanilla
1/2 tsp. almond extract
1/3 C. extra light olive oil

Mix well.

Break the lettuce into bite sized pieces and add to a large serving bowl.

In a frying pan over low to medium heat, add the sugar. Sprinkle in the almonds. Cook, stirring constantly, until the sugar melts and the almonds are coated. Dump out onto a cookie sheet and spread out into a single layer. Let cool.



Once the almonds are cool, add them to the lettuce. Add the craisins and purple onion also. Add dressing just before serving.


Serves 10 people.

Broccoli Salad

Surprisingly, this is a recipe I found on my own when I was in college.
I say this is "surprising" because sometimes it seems like the things I ate in college, were really ONLY good while I was IN college. BUT I have to say, this recipe CONTINUES to get GREAT reviews every time!



Salad:

1 lb. broccoli florets
1/2 lb. bacon (cooked & crumbled)
1/2 C. cashews
1/2 C. raisins

Combine all together in a serving bowl.



Dressing:

1 C. mayo
1/2 C. sugar
1 TBS. vinegar

Mix well.

Add dressing to salad immediately before serving.
